Title: The Innovative Contributions of Luke A. Kassekert: A Glimpse into Cancer Treatment Innovations
Introduction: Luke A. Kassekert, an accomplished inventor based in Lino Lakes, Minnesota, has made significant strides in the field of pharmaceutical research. With a focus on cancer treatment, his contributions showcase the vital role of inventors in advancing medical science. Kassekert holds a notable patent that reflects his dedication to discovery and innovation.
Latest Patents: Kassekert's most recent patent revolves around a compound known as Callyspongiolide and its analogs. This invention includes methods of making and using these compounds, which are designed to treat various forms of cancer. The details of the patent include compounds that can exist in various forms such as salts, polymorphs, prodrugs, solvates, or clathrates, paving the way for potentially groundbreaking therapeutic options.
